    Commercial Irrigation Replacement Process Florida

    How We Replace Your System Right

    The process starts with a complete assessment of your current system, water pressure, and coverage needs. We map out problem areas, identify why your existing system is failing, and design a replacement that addresses those specific issues rather than just copying what was there before.

    Installation involves removing old components, upgrading water lines where necessary, and installing new sprinkler heads, controllers, and valves positioned for optimal coverage. We test each zone thoroughly, adjust timing and pressure settings, and program smart controllers that automatically adjust watering schedules based on weather conditions and seasonal needs.

    Once your new commercial sprinkler replacement is operational, we provide training on the system controls and establish a maintenance schedule that prevents the problems that killed your old system. You get documentation of all components, warranty information, and direct contact for any questions or service needs.

    How long does a commercial sprinkler replacement take to complete?

    Most commercial sprinkler replacements in Juno Ridge take 2-5 days depending on property size and system complexity. The timeline includes removing old components, installing new irrigation lines where needed, positioning new sprinkler heads and controllers, and testing all zones for proper coverage.

    Weather can affect the schedule, particularly during Florida’s rainy season when ground conditions make excavation challenging. However, the work is planned to minimize disruption to your business operations, with most installation happening during off-hours when possible.

    You’ll have a detailed timeline before work begins, including which areas will be affected each day and when water service will be temporarily interrupted for connections. The goal is completing quality work while keeping your business running normally.

    If you’re calling for repairs more than twice per year, have zones that never seem to work right, or notice your water bills climbing despite no increase in landscaped area, replacement is often more cost-effective than continued repairs.

    Other signs include controllers that are more than 10 years old, sprinkler heads that can’t be adjusted properly, frequent pipe breaks, or coverage that leaves dead spots no matter how many heads you replace. Systems installed before 2010 often lack the efficiency features that are now standard.

    The decision usually comes down to math: if repair costs over the next two years will exceed 60% of replacement cost, replacement makes financial sense. Plus, new systems come with warranties and efficiency features that old systems can’t match, making replacement the smarter long-term investment for most commercial properties.
